If a , b , c are unit vectors and the maximum value of | a - b |^2+| b - c |^2+| c - a |^2 is k , then k (2 a ^2+3 b ^2-4 c ^2 )=
Options
- A6
- B8
- C9
- D12
Correct answer
C. 9
Step-by-step solution
a , b and c are unit vectors. gathered | a |=| b |=| c |=1 Now, | a - b |^2+| b - c |^2+| c - a |^2 =2 ( a ^2+ b ^2+ c ^2 )-2( a b + b c + c a ) =2(1+1+1)-2( a b + b c + c a ) gathered | a - b |^2+| b - c |^2+| c - a |^2 is maximum when 2( a b + b c + c a ) is minimum using. | a + b + c |^2= a ^2+ b ^2+ c ^2+2( a b + b c + c a ) We know that, aligned & a + b + c =0, then a b + b c + c a is minimum & 0=1+1+1+2( a b + b c + c a ) & 2( a b + b c + c a )=-3 & Substitute in Eq. (i) & =6-(-3)=9 aligned Substitute in Eq.
